If you know any company that sell bottled stuff ie. veterinary surgeries, pharmacies and the like, the medicines etc may come with polystyrene beading around them for protection and I'd say they'd be only too glad to give it to you. These beads would not be as small as regular beads, usually shamrock shaped. I got two beanbag covers in IKEA Sweden years ago for E5 each and as I work on a commercial farm I get the beans there. I do find though that they get a bit flat over time but I am lucky enough to have a steady supply.
